REMARKABLE SCENE

DURING LECTURE ON SPIRITUALISM CONAN DOYLE CREATES A SENSATION BY TMEGBAPH.—PRESS ASSOCIATION. —Copyright. (Rec. April 8, 5.5 p.m.) New York, April 6. A remarkable scene was witnessed at the Carnegie Hall during Sir Arthur Conan Doyle’s lecture on spiritualism, when without warning Sir Arthur flashed a. picture taken at the Cenotaph in London during the Armistice Day anniversary services. The picture revealed in a haze above the heads of the kneeling crowd scores of dim faces, supposedly those of dead soldiers. The entire audience was stunned during a minute’s tense silence. Then women screamed, and convulsive sobbing and expressions of fear were heard throughout the hall. Sir Arthur said the photograph was taken by Mrs. Dean, a London medi um, the" camera being focused upon a group of mediums attending the ser-vice.—Aus.-N-Z, Cable Aesn,
